Nick: hell__ E-mail: something with @ Board: Gemini Lake Contents: $ ./ich_descriptors_tool -f SPI.bin The flash image has a size of 8388608 [0x800000] bytes. Peculiar firmware descriptor, assuming Apollo Lake compatibility. The firmware descriptor looks like a Skylake/Sunrise Point descriptor. However, the read frequency isn't set to 17MHz (the only valid value). Please report this message, the output of `ich_descriptors_tool` for your descriptor and the output of `lspci -nn` to flashrom@flashrom.org Assuming chipset '9 series Wildcat Point'. === Content Section === FLVALSIG 0x0ff0a55a FLMAP0 0x00040003 FLMAP1 0x17100208 FLMAP2 0x00000000 --- Details --- NR (Number of Regions): 1 FRBA (Flash Region Base Address): 0x040 NC (Number of Components): 1 FCBA (Flash Component Base Address): 0x030 ISL (ICH/PCH/SoC Strap Length): 23 FISBA/FPSBA (Flash ICH/PCH/SoC Strap Base Addr): 0x100 NM (Number of Masters): 3 FMBA (Flash Master Base Address): 0x080 MSL/PSL (MCH/PROC Strap Length): 0 FMSBA (Flash MCH/PROC Strap Base Address): 0x000 === Component Section === FLCOMP 0x125882f4 FLILL 0xad604221 --- Details --- Component 1 density: 8 MB Component 2 is not used. Read Clock Frequency: 50 MHz Read ID and Status Clock Freq.: reserved Write and Erase Clock Freq.: reserved Fast Read is supported. Fast Read Clock Frequency: reserved Dual Output Fast Read Support: enabled Invalid instruction 0: 0x21 Invalid instruction 1: 0x42 Invalid instruction 2: 0x60 Invalid instruction 3: 0xad === Region Section === FLREG0 0x00000000 --- Details --- Region 0 (Descr. ) 0x00000000 - 0x00000fff === Master Section === FLMSTR1 0xffffff00 FLMSTR2 0xffffff00 FLMSTR3 0x7ff7ff00 --- Details --- Descr. BIOS ME GbE Platf. BIOS rw rw rw rw rw ME rw rw rw rw rw GbE rw rw rw w rw === Upper Map Section === FLUMAP1 0x000008df --- Details --- VTL (length in DWORDS) = 8 VTBA (base address) = 0x000df0 VSCC Table: 4 entries JID0 = 0x0000471f VSCC0 = 0x20152015 Manufacturer ID 0x1f, Device ID 0x4700 BES=0x1, WG=1, WSR=0, WEWS=1, EO=0x20 JID1 = 0x001760ef VSCC1 = 0x20252025 Manufacturer ID 0xef, Device ID 0x6017 BES=0x1, WG=1, WSR=0, WEWS=0, EO=0x20 JID2 = 0x001760c8 VSCC2 = 0x20252025 Manufacturer ID 0xc8, Device ID 0x6017 BES=0x1, WG=1, WSR=0, WEWS=0, EO=0x20 JID3 = 0x001860ef VSCC3 = 0x20252025 Manufacturer ID 0xef, Device ID 0x6018 BES=0x1, WG=1, WSR=0, WEWS=0, EO=0x20 === Softstraps === --- North/MCH/PROC (0 entries) --- ISL (23) is greater than the current maximum of 18 entries. Only the first 18 entries will be printed. --- South/ICH/PCH (18 entries) --- STRP0 = 0x000000a1 STRP1 = 0x00ff0000 STRP2 = 0xd8000080 STRP3 = 0x00000665 STRP4 = 0x00000000 STRP5 = 0x00600304 STRP6 = 0x00500000 STRP7 = 0x00000012 STRP8 = 0x00005007 STRP9 = 0x00000000 STRP10 = 0x0000002c STRP11 = 0x00000000 STRP12 = 0x00050504 STRP13 = 0x00004000 STRP14 = 0x00000000 STRP15 = 0x00004000 STRP16 = 0x00000000 STRP17 = 0x00000000 The meaning of the descriptor straps are unknown yet. The MAC address might be at offset 0x0: 01:78:00:34:80:7a